Vlade Divac as the Kings' most valuable player over the first half of this season? We can do that. Most days, it doesn't even feel like a stretch.

Geoff Petrie will almost go that far, in fact, and Petrie likes to anoint individual favorites about as much as he likes to hop up on the bar and do the macarena. But the Kings' president understands that, in the confluence of nearly impossible-to-separate factors that got Sacramento off to the searing start that has led to this 33-10 standing, Divac was huge from the beginning.

"Certainly starting like that," Petrie said Wednesday as the Kings prepared to fly to Seattle to face the SuperSonics tonight. "And Mike (Bibby) being new, totally new. And the way we play, he (Divac) is the fulcrum of a lot of what we do offensively."
